Further, they provide valuable insights for non-financial services... flow lightsaberflow lightsWebReport bribery and corruption. If you, your employee or agent have been solicited for a bribe you should notify the relevant organisations: the UK Embassy of the country you’re operating in. the local anti-corruption authority. the project donor, if you’re working on a donor-funded project.
